Examples
Referring to fig. 1-4, the present invention provides a technical solution: a fixed lifting material transferring machine for processing tablets comprises a lifting motor 1, a feeding barrel 2, a lifting propeller 3, a bracket 4 and a hopper 5, wherein the lifting motor 1 is fixed at the end part of the feeding barrel 2 through bolts, the lifting propeller 3 is installed inside the feeding barrel 2, an output shaft of the lifting motor 1 penetrates through the feeding barrel 2 and is fixedly connected with the lifting propeller 3, the lower end of the feeding barrel 2 is fixed with the lifting motor 1 through welding, the lower end of the hopper 5 is welded on the surface of the lower end of the feeding barrel 2, and the feeding barrel 2 is communicated with the hopper 5, a filter plate 7 is arranged in the hopper 5, a vibration component, a limiting component and a buffer component are arranged between the filter plate 7 and the hopper 5, the vibration component comprises a vibration motor 8 and an eccentric wheel 9, the vibration motor 8 is fixed on the outer surface of the hopper 5 through a bolt, the eccentric wheel 9 is arranged on an output shaft of the vibration motor 8, and the eccentric wheel 9 is in contact with the filter plate 7.
In this embodiment, filter plate 7 passes through the vibration subassembly, location subassembly and buffering subassembly are installed in the inside of hopper 5, the subassembly that cushions simultaneously comprises vibrating motor 8 and eccentric wheel 9, make vibrating motor 8's output shaft area eccentric wheel 9 rotate in the inside of hopper 5, eccentric wheel 9 and filter plate 7 contact simultaneously, make filter plate 7 rock from top to bottom under the effect of vibration subassembly, the material of being convenient for enters into the bottom of just arriving hopper 5 through filter plate 7, the material of being convenient for is through promoting motor 1, feed cylinder 2 and the ascending lifting of promotion screw 3.
Specifically, the limiting assembly comprises a limiting ring 10 and a limiting rod 11, the limiting ring 10 is welded on the inner surface of the hopper 5, the upper end of the limiting rod 11 is fixedly connected with the lower surface of the filter plate 7, and the lower end of the limiting rod 11 is inserted into the limiting ring 10.
In this embodiment, the positioning assembly formed by combining the limiting ring 10 and the limiting rod 11 enables the limiting rod 11 to move inside the limiting ring 10 when the filter plate 7 moves up and down, so that the stability of the filter plate 7 moving inside the hopper 5 is improved, and the filter plate 7 is prevented from deflecting when moving.
Specifically, the buffer assembly comprises a movable groove 6 and a buffer spring 12, the movable groove 6 is formed in the inner surface of the hopper 5, the outer edge of the filter plate 7 is in contact with the movable groove 6, one end of the buffer spring 12 is fixedly connected with the movable groove 6, and the other end of the buffer spring 12 is fixedly connected with the filter plate 7.
In this embodiment, the buffer assembly formed by combining the buffer spring 12 and the movable groove 6 allows the filter plate 7 to be reset by the buffer spring 12 when moving inside the hopper 5, so that the flexibility of the filter plate 7 moving inside the hopper 5 is increased, meanwhile, one end of the buffer spring 12 is fixedly connected with the movable groove 6, and the other end of the buffer spring 12 is fixedly connected with the filter plate 7.
Specifically, two vibration motors 8 are arranged on the outer surface of the hopper 5, and two eccentric wheels 9 are arranged on the output shaft of each vibration motor 8.
In this embodiment, two vibration motors 8 are installed on the outer surface of the hopper 5, and two eccentric wheels 9 are installed on the output shaft of each vibration motor 8, so that the four eccentric wheels 9 are respectively located at four corners of the lower surface of the filter plate 7.
Specifically, the eccentric wheel 9 is a combination of a half circle and a half ellipse.
In the embodiment, the eccentric wheel 9 which is a combination of a half circle and a half ellipse is used for facilitating the up-and-down movement of the filter plate 7 under the action of the eccentric wheel 9.
Specifically, the filter plate 7 is a square plate-shaped structure, and the surface of the filter plate 7 is provided with air holes at equal intervals.
In the embodiment, the surface of the filter plate 7 is provided with the air holes at equal intervals, so that materials can conveniently pass through the filter plate 7.
Specifically, the feeding cylinder 2 is of a long tubular structure, and the lifting propeller 3 is of a spiral structure.
In this embodiment, through the promotion screw 3 that is heliciform structure, the inside material of a feed cylinder 2 of being convenient for removes under the effect that promotes screw 3.
